Luxurious Raspberry Pistachio Macarons

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up (100 g) almond flour
  • 1 3/4 cups (200 g) powdered sugar
  • 3 large egg whites (aged at room temperature)
  • 1/4 cup (50 g) granulated sugar
  • 1/4 cup (25 g) finely ground pistachios
  • 1/4 cup raspberry jam
  • 1/2 cup (115 g) un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• A few drops green and pink food coloring (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 300°F (150°C) and line two baking sheets with silicone mats.
  2. Sift together almond flour, pistachios, and powdered sugar in a bowl.
  3. In another bowl, whip egg whites until foamy, then gradually add granulated sugar until stiff peaks form.
  4. Gently fold dry ingredients into the meringue until the batter flows like thick lava.
  5. Pipe even rounds onto the baking mats, tap trays to remove air bubbles, and let them rest 30–45 minutes until a skin forms.
  6. Bake for 14–16 minutes, one tray at a time, until shells are set with their signature feet. Cool completely before removing.
  7. Prepare the filling by creaming butter, raspberry jam, and vanilla extract together until smooth.
  8. Sandwich cooled shells with the filling and refrigerate overnight for best texture.

Notes

  • Let the macarons mature overnight for a richer flavor and softer texture.
  • Use room-temperature egg whites for better meringue stability.
  • Macarons can be frozen for up to one month in an airtight container.
